Перейти из форума на сайт.

НовостиФайловые архивы
ПоискАктивные темыТоп лист
ПравилаКто в on-line?
Вход Забыли пароль? Первый раз на этом сайте? Регистрация
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» 1C Программирование и поддержка

Модерирует : ShIvADeSt

ShIvADeSt (03-04-2009 02:03): Продолжение тут
http://forum.ru-board.com/topic.cgi?forum=33&topic=10256#1
 Версия для печати • ПодписатьсяДобавить в закладки
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100

   

ShIvADeSt



Moderator
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Тема для программирования !!!
Это продолжение темы, предыдущие части доступны тут


ПРОГРАММЫ  1С:Предприятие 1C - 1C: Вопросы по конфигурациям

ВАРЕЗНИК   1C:Предприятие 7.7 - 1С:Предприятие v.8.x - 1C Диск ИТС - 1С: Совместимо 8.х

Топик 1C Ebooks
ЗДЕСЬ (обновлено 27.03.2009) - небольшая библиотечка (книги, документация, видео, утилиты) по 1С, финансам, бухучету и т.п.
Все рассортировано по версиям...

Для заблудившихся в трех соснах >>> FAQ по форуму RU.Board

Всего записей: 3956 | Зарегистр. 29-07-2003 | Отправлено: 02:30 06-02-2008 | Исправлено: vkramnik, 21:26 27-03-2009
deman_ru

Junior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ору

Цитата:
Akam1

да, не повляется в форме справочника. а что значит разместил? я просто, добавил новый реквизит, выбрал тип и все, или что то еще нужно делать?

Всего записей: 96 | Зарегистр. 28-04-2008 | Отправлено: 17:48 01-04-2009
tohanew



Full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
deman_ru
конечно, теперь нужно перейти на закладку формы и разместить этот реквизит на форме документа.
Но раз вы даже этого не знаете, то лучше обратиться к специалистам, будет быстрее и проще.

----------
Адреналин оптом.

Всего записей: 529 | Зарегистр. 22-09-2006 | Отправлено: 18:29 01-04-2009
dias65



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
An4eus

Цитата:
а точно та отчётность для конфигурации?

Код:
1С:Предприятие 7.7
Регламентированные отчеты
Конфигурация "Бухгалтерский учет для Украины"
Конфигурация "Производство+Услуги+Бухгалтерия для Украины".
Регламентированная отчетность за 1 квартал 2009 года
 
Обновление 09q1002 от 27.03.2009 г.                      (Это из release.txt)
Ну и конфига - Бухгалтерский учет для Украины 272 релиз

Всего записей: 277 | Зарегистр. 28-11-2006 | Отправлено: 18:44 01-04-2009 | Исправлено: dias65, 18:47 01-04-2009
filthy

Newbie
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
В собственном отчете понадобилось при обработке ячейки таблицы выводить Отчет.РасчетыСКонтрАгентамиСЗачетом, ну само собой уже заполненный и сформированный.
 
Сделала копию типовой Формы-Отчета, там ПриОткрытии() определила все переменные из формы, и обозвав процедуру Сформировать() - функцией, вызываем ее из тела модуля этой же формы.  
 
Из ячейки своего отчета передаем код Контрагента из Справочника в Форму-Отчет, в Форме-Отчете выбираем по коду контрагента.  
 
То есть: есть свой отчет, из него вызываем немного правленую копию стандартного отчета по расчетам с контрагентами.
 
Теперь проблема:  
 
Есть там чекбокс "РазворотПоОперациям". Если РазворотПоОперациям = 1 то появляется ошибка. Но только в моей копии ошибка. В итоге по операциям не ворочает. И грешу я на передачу значения в переменную "СпКонтрагентов"
 
Есть там такой код:
 

Код:
Если СпКонтрагентов.РазмерСписка() <> 0 Тогда
Би.ИспользоватьСубконто(ВидыСубконто.Контрагенты,СпКонтрагентов,1);

 
Переменная СпКонтрагентов - это список значений из формы, он там выбирается. Поскольку нам уже готовый отчет надо, делаю так:
 

Код:
КонтрАгент = СоздатьОбъект("Справочник.Контрагенты");
КонтрАгент.ВыбратьЭлементы();
КонтрАгент.НайтиПоКоду("0000001200");
СпКонтрагентов.ДобавитьЗначение(КонтрАгент);

 
В этом случае в форме то он появится, а вот в отчете - нет.  
 
Если сделать через СпКонтрагентов.ПолучитьЗначение(1) в ИспользоватьСубконто - то он появится и в отчете. Почему?  
 
Может вообще не тем путем пошла?  
 

Всего записей: 9 | Зарегистр. 11-10-2006 | Отправлено: 17:12 02-04-2009
An4eus



Silver Member
Редактировать | Профиль | Сообщение | ICQ | Цитировать | Сообщить модератору
dias65
ну вообще странно...
я с Ураиной не работаю => на вскидку не могу сказать....
может саму конфигурацию нужно обновить?
 
filthy
Цитата:
Может вообще не тем путем пошла?  
ага..
для начало надо объяснить, что унужно конкретно, а то я, если честно, ничего не понял из поста!

----------
Век живи - век учись!

Всего записей: 3768 | Зарегистр. 23-07-2007 | Отправлено: 17:35 02-04-2009
dias65



Member
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
An4eus
Это последняя конфигурация. Просто по следам последних изменений налогов на ЗП изменились бланки, и, соответственно, выложили регламентированную отчетность.
Код:
        Для кв = 1 По 4 Цикл
        Если ФЗПБезраб[кв] = 0 Тогда  
        ВыбОбласть = Таблица.Область("Табл_"+кв);      
        ВыбОбласть.Значение = 0;                        //здесь вызывается ошибка
//            Табл_1 = 0;    Табл_2 = 0; Табл_3 = 0; Табл_4 = 0;
        КонецЕсли;
    КонецЦикла;
Этот код вызывает ошибку в новом отчете, хотя в предыдущих тот же код отрабатывал нормально.  
 
Упс, нашел, в чем дело. Когда переделывали бланк, забыли обозвать переделанные области в соответствии с кодом.

Всего записей: 277 | Зарегистр. 28-11-2006 | Отправлено: 23:04 02-04-2009 | Исправлено: dias65, 23:14 02-04-2009
   

Страницы: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100

Компьютерный форум Ru.Board » Компьютеры » Прикладное программирование » 1C Программирование и поддержка
ShIvADeSt (03-04-2009 02:03): Продолжение тут
http://forum.ru-board.com/topic.cgi?forum=33&topic=10256#1


Реклама на форуме Ru.Board.

Powered by Ikonboard "v2.1.7b" © 2000 Ikonboard.com
Modified by Ru.B0ard
© Ru.B0ard 2000-2024

BitCoin: 1NGG1chHtUvrtEqjeerQCKDMUi6S6CG4iC

Рейтинг.ru